Subject: [PATCH RESEND 0/2] kbuild: dead code elimination: ftrace fixes

Enabling dead code & data elimination currently breaks ftrace operation,
as the __mcount_loc section is removed (as it is not referenced directly
anywhere in the code).
Moreover, there are a lot of entries missing in the __mcount_loc section
as the recordmcount tool doesn't currently properly handle the section
names as created by the use of -ffunction-sections.
The following 2 patches fix that behaviour.
They are based on next-20161208.
Marcin Nowakowski (2):
kbuild: keep __mcount_loc table through dead code elimination
recordmcount: fix mcount recording with -ffunction-sections
